Peter Capaldi

Peter Capaldi was born on April 14, 1958 in Glasgow, Scotland. He started out attending drama classes in his youth, which prepared him for his acceptance in the Glasgow School of Art. Upon his graduation he received his breakthrough role in the film Local Hero (1983). He starred in numerous roles over the years, frequenting BBC productions throughout his career. Notably he had the role of Malcom Tucker in BBC’s The Thick of It from 2005-2012. This role landed him awards for Male Performance in a Comedy Role (2010) at the BAFTA Television Awards, and Best TV Comedy Actor (2010, 2012) at the British Comedy Awards. Since, his popularity soared further with his role in Doctor Who from 2013 onward.
